The Biggest Pros and Cons
The 2008 Cobalt 222 offers a blend of performance, style, and comfort, making it a popular choice for recreational boating enthusiasts. Here are some of the key pros and cons:
Pros
Stylish Design: The Cobalt 222 features a sleek, modern look with high-quality finishes and attention to detail.
Comfortable Seating: It offers spacious and comfortable seating for up to 10 passengers, with plush cushions and thoughtful layout.
Smooth Ride: Known for its solid construction and deep-V hull, the boat delivers a smooth and stable ride even in choppy waters.
Powerful Performance: Equipped with reliable engine options, the Cobalt 222 provides good acceleration and cruising speeds suitable for water sports and day cruising.
Well-Equipped: Comes with ample storage, a well-designed helm, and convenient features such as swim platforms and optional accessories.
Good Resale Value: Cobalt boats generally maintain strong resale value due to their reputation for quality.
Cons
Limited Cabin Space: The 222 is primarily a bowrider and lacks an enclosed cabin, which may limit comfort for overnight stays or protection from bad weather.
Fuel Consumption: Depending on the engine choice and usage, fuel efficiency may be moderate, leading to higher running costs.
Price Point: When new, Cobalt boats tend to be priced at the higher end of the market, which might be a consideration for budget-conscious buyers.
Maintenance Costs: High-quality materials and finishes can sometimes mean higher maintenance and repair costs compared to more basic models.
